Is Your Old Garage Door Struggling to Work?

Have you noticed that your door is moving slower than normal or producing unusual sounds? These issues often indicate an aging door.

Additionally, frequent repairs are draining your wallet. When an old mechanism starts to fail, you will find yourself calling for repairs more often. It might seem like a quick repair is the best option, but the fees can mount up fast.

Instead of sinking money into a broken garage door, it is worth considering a replacement. A new door can save you the frustration of repeated breakdowns and the expense of constant fixes.

Can You Spot the Wear and Tear on the Sectional Panels?

Sometimes, the signs are as clear as day. Look closely at your garage panel—what do you see?

Are there cracks, warping, or rust?

If your old garage panel has cracks, dents, or rust, it is not just an eyesore; it is also a safety concern. Over time, the Des Moines weather and daily use take a toll, often causing damage you cannot fully repair.

Do you see faded garage door paint or peeling layers?

A faded, peeling door can make your entire home look outdated. If your door has seen better days, replacing it is a quick way to give your home a fresh, modern look.

Is Your Overhead Door Still Safe and Secure?

Safety should always come first, especially when it comes to something as important as your garage. Hence, it’s time for a garage door replacement if your door is:

Lacking Modern Safety Features

Old garage door openers often lack essential safety features like sensors or auto-reverse. These improvements are not simply great to have; they can keep people from getting hurt or having accidents.

Easy to Break Into

A worn-out door or outdated garage mechanism can be a security risk. In contrast, newer doors come with advanced locks and sturdy materials, making your home much harder to break into.

Is Your Old Door Driving Up Electricity Costs?

Your old garage system might be costing you more than you think.

Poor Insulation Letting in Drafts

If your garage becomes too hot in the summer or too cold in the winter, the old door might be to blame. However, modern doors have better insulation to keep your home comfortable and reduce energy bills.

Old Materials, More Problems

Older doors were not designed with today’s energy efficiency standards. Consequently, replacing your old door can make a big difference in your monthly bills.

What’s Causing All That Garage Door Noise?

Does your garage wake the neighbors every time it opens? Noisy doors are not just annoying; they are often a sign of trouble.

Grinding, Squealing, or Rattling

These sounds usually point to worn-out parts in your old garage mechanism. While lubricating the tracks might help for a while, it is often a temporary fix. A replacement is a more permanent solution.

Inconsistent Performance

Does your garage system only work when it feels like it? That’s another red flag. A new door will give you reliable operation every time.
